Kabul: In Kabul, the capital of Afghanistan, on Tuesday (April 19, 2022) there were three serial blasts targeting the training center and school. In which the news of the death of a large number of people has come to the fore. According to media reports, the first blast took place near Mumtaz School in western Kabul, while the second blast took place in front of Abdul Rahim Shahid School. According to media reports, 25 children have been killed in these blasts. The blast took place in Kabul's Dasht-e-Barchi area when school children were leaving the school.

Afghanistan's Interior Ministry has confirmed the blast near Abdul Rahim Shaheed High School. The ministry said that the investigation into the incident has been started. At the same time, in media reports, it is being told from Afghanistan that our Shia brothers have been targeted. The school was attacked by three to five fidayeen attackers. Three of them have detonated bombs. At the same time, it is also being told in the media report that the first blast took place near the Mumtaz Training Center in the west of Kabul. With the death of 25 in the attack, there are reports of many people getting injured.

A journalist covering local Afghanistan news tweeted about the incident, writing that, 'A fidayeen attacker attacked a school in Kabul, a predominantly Shia-dominated area. The blast took place at the main exit gate of Abdul Rahim Shahid School where there was a crowd of students, a teacher who surprisingly survived the attack told me that several people were feared dead.'
